Summary

Eight students from mainland China chart their learning journeys across national and continental boundaries and socio-cultural contexts. Each presents a reflective autobiographical account of their experiences of studying in both China and the West. Their reflections are structured around the turning points and life-changing choices they have made in chasing their dreams. Their dreams of the future will affect not only their own fates but also the future of Chinese civil society. These students embody its emergent intellectual and professional cadre. Chinese Learning Journeysoffers a scholarly resource for the academic research community working in the field of international student experience. It provides higher education practitioners with important insights into the cultural backgrounds and aspirations of overseas students. Those responsible for overseas student recruitment and welfare will find it invaluable, as will those working in the areas of language support and academic writing and other students who are chasing the dream. Chapters include the reflective accounts of: an undergraduate student in Liverpool; a postgraduate student in London; a doctoral student in Manchester; a post-doctoral researcher in Hong Kong; a Shanghai solicitor in London; a teacher of foreign language in Hong Kong; a Chinese academic in a Welsh university; and the author himself.
